从品牌网站建设到网络营销策划,从策略到执行的一站式服务
你的意思是
松滋网站建设公司成都创新互联,松滋网站设计制作,有大型网站制作公司丰富经验。已为松滋上千余家提供企业网站建设服务。企业网站搭建\成都外贸网站建设要多少钱,请找那个售后服务好的松滋做网站的公司定做!
如a表有个name字段存了 1-2-3-4
那么我的理解就是 你想 查询显示的结果就是
北京-上海-山东-广州 ?
想把a表name字段里的1-2-3-4替换成 我写的样子?
不得不说 你数据规划问题特别的大。并且。。。。。。这种方式多表查询会出现乘积现象。
容我先想想 怎么查
你这个算是完蛋了。要只是想看效果的话有办法 不过要多执行几次语句 逼近一次只能替换一个字符
首先 你把你的a表 复制一下 名字我们取c好了
例如 1是北京 其他 234 我随意取名字
update c set name=replace(name,'1','北京');
update c set name=replace(name,'2','上海');
update c set name=replace(name,'3','山东');
依次类推 最后 c表就会变成这个样子了。
所有字段都替换完成了
个人建议 趁着这次把表关系理理清楚。
当然 你也可以使用 select 来查看 这样不需要修改了 语句一次看完也可以
select replace(name,'1-2-3-4','北京-上海-山东-广州 ') as from c
北京-上海-山东-广州
SELECT COUNT(0),PROVINCE_NAME FROM (SELECT B.CITY_NAME ,A.PROVINCE_NAME FROM PROVINCE_TABLE A,CITY_TABLE B WHERE A.PID=B.PID) GROUP BY PROVINCE_NAME
这些省份信息是存储在你的某张表中吗?那你直接使用select语句查询就可以了。
成都网站建设公司地址:成都市青羊区太升南路288号锦天国际A座10层 建设咨询028-86922220
成都快上网科技有限公司-四川网站建设设计公司 | 蜀ICP备19037934号 Copyright 2020,ALL Rights Reserved cdkjz.cn | 成都网站建设 | © Copyright 2020版权所有.
专家团队为您提供成都网站建设,成都网站设计,成都品牌网站设计,成都营销型网站制作等服务,成都建网站就找快上网! | 成都网站建设哪家好? | 网站建设地图